QUOTE(darrenboy @ Nov 20 2013, 02:31 PM) If you have just joined the Big 4 firms, do they allow new staff to take annual leave within the first year of joining, or in first year nothing and only 2nd year can take (i.e. it means first year have to apply unpaid leave if have to be away from office). You are entitled to annual leave even in your first year.. How many days of annual leave you get depends on when you join the firm.. Or, does big 4 firms allow you to take annual leave but you accumulate it as the year goes along? I joined in mid september... so I got like 4.5 days of AL... it's pro rated.. Big 4 are quite generous when it comes to benefits especially when compared if all the other firms. Do have to take note though that.. having annual leave doesn't mean your annual leave will be approved for sure.. it really depends on the timing of your annual leave |
